Transaction 4d30f3ef7ccb80069d2371c0a7f5a780b2e3e918d2707ecea1c707ee6221ad35

120 Input
1 Outputs
  • 4d30f3ef7ccb80069d2371c0a7f5a780b2e3e918d2707ecea1c707ee6221ad35:0
  • value  24908953
    address  1GrwDkr33gT6LuumniYjKEGjTLhsL5kmqC